While western releases included a dual-audio option, the Japanese version was built from the ground up for the native voice cast. The character mouth movements, dramatic timing, and battle cries are perfectly synced to legendary voice actors like Masako Nozawa (Goku/Gohan/Goten) and Ryō Horikawa (Vegeta).
